So when you add our current $200 off each window with the tax incentives you may qualify for, your energy-efficient Louisville windows may end up cheaper than the regular windows anyway.Choose Louisville Windows That Were Built to LastHigh quality Louisville windows will not need to be replaced for many years to come. They can withstand a beating by the weather, fading by the sun, and the expanding and contracting that happens at different temperature levels.These windows also will not warp when the hot sun shines on them like other lower quality windows do.So when you are comparing the price of great Louisville windows with the cheaper windows that are available, take into consideration how many times you will have to replace the cheaper windows before you will have to replace the initially more expensive, but higher quality Louisville windows. You may find that the cheaper windows end up being more expensive in the long run.Choose Louisville Windows That Match the Architecture of Your HomeCertain window styles just don’t match the architecture of a home. For example, having vinyl sliding windows installed in an early 1900’s Victorian just doesn’t look right, and in some cases is not acceptable if you live in a neighborhood with historical preservation rules.So don’t just jump at the first cheap windows that you see or are offered to you. Take your time and select the style of Louisville windows that are going to make your home look good and not ones that are going to stick out like a sore thumb to those that admire your home.
